Tamayo meets Academy Award-nominated sound engineer during Celebrate! Innovation week

Contribued photo

Des Moines Area Community College (DMACC) West Campus second-year student Carlos Tamayo (left) of Osceola poses with 17-time Academy Award-nominated sound engineer Greg Russell at the Celebrate! Innovation (ci) week event. Russell has spent 40 years as a sound engineer, working on films such as Pearl Harbor, the Transformers series, Spider-Man, National Treasure and The DaVinci Code. He said he still loves what he does. Russell told the capacity-crowd audience that he mixes sounds so you feel like you are right in the middle of the scene. Other ciWeek speakers included Apollo astronauts Ken Mattingly and Al Worden, beatbox world champion Kaila Mullady, New York Times best-selling author and “zombie expert” Max Brooks, world-renowned rock climber Kevin Jorgeson and Former University of Iowa Wrestling Coach and Gold Medalist Dan Gable.
